Debt Settlement and Relieving Your Financial Stress

Many consumers who find themselves knee deep in debt carry the feeling of shame and embarrassment along with their financial burdens. While there are a number of people who end up in a debt relief program as a result of irresponsible spending habits and a lack of basic financial management, the majority of debtors do not fall into this category. Rather, the majority of people who experience the stress of being in debt are average, hard working, responsible individuals who may have fallen behind on their payments for a number of reasons. The last thing a consumer should do when approaching their financial troubles is to feel ashamed of enrolling into a debt settlement program for help. It is currently estimated that the average household carries roughly $15-18 thousand dollars in debt. There is no reason to feel isolated. Rather, it is necessary to address the problem, generate a financial plan, and eventually reach a solution to free yourself from the negative consequences that result from owing your creditors money. There are more than a few reasons why the average person falls into debt. I will discuss one of the more prevalent causes, which should illuminate the fact that there is nothing to be ashamed of, when it comes to debt, as long as coming up with a plan to solve the problem is something you are striving to generate.

For the majority of debtors, the experience of a hardship is at the root of the problem. Many people fall under this category and actively seek out debt settlement as a form of debt relief. Whether it may be medical bills from an accident or particular illness, or you have just lost your job and are struggling to find employment, certain hardships can have a serious effect in determining when your payments can be made, and for how much you can afford at a given time. What must be understood is the fact that these hardships are primarily out of the control of the consumer. To consider yourself liable for say, hypothetically, getting into a car wreck in which you were not at fault, is completely unnecessary. And it is entirely understandable why, especially if these bills are extremely high, which medical bills tend to be, you may fall behind or have trouble making these payments.

Debt settlement is a form of debt relief that offers help for people experiencing hardships that prevent them from making the necessary payments to their creditors. It should not be viewed as an option for the financially helpless; consumers from every social class turn to debt settlement companies for representation. It has proven to be a successful means in which consumers can eliminate their debts and begin a life free of those financial obligations that served as a burden for so long.
